Overview
KidSportTM is a national not-for-profit organization that provides financial assistance for registration fees and equipment to kids aged 18 and under. Through a confidential application process KidSportTM provides grants so they can play a season of sport. Since its creation in 1993, over 450,000 kids across the country have been given the chance to play sport through KidSportTM grants and sport introduction programming.
Mission Statement
KidSportTM believes that no kid should be left on the sidelines and all should be given the opportunity to experience the positive benefits of organized sports. KidSportTM provides support to children in order to remove financial barriers that prevent them from playing organized sport.
KidSportTM Chapters
Nationally, KidSportTM provides support and resources to a network of 178 provincial/territorial and community chapters. Each chapter manages all operations, including fundraising, application intake and grant distribution for its community.
Benefits to the Community
KidSportTM believes in the values and benefits of kids playing organized sport and we know that sport will provide them with the opportunity to:
- Become physically active
- Improve their self-esteem and self-confidence
- Learn life-long skills
- Improve their academic performance
- Make new friends
- Share and celebrate their culture
- Contribute to a strong, healthy community
